Bonuses: Those sweet, sweet bonuses can be tempting, but don't get blinded by the flashing lights. Always, always read the terms and conditions. Pay close attention to wagering requirements (how many times you need to play through the bonus before you can withdraw winnings) and any game restrictions. A seemingly generous bonus can be a bit of a fizzer if it comes with impossible playthrough requirements.
